Was he ever a smoker?
No, oddly enough he only smoked about 4-5 years at the beginning of his career, out of his entire 69 year old life, and - get this - NEVER learned how to inhale! I know, it's hilarious. He was an occasional co-smoker while in relationships with (heavy) smokers Joan Collins and Natalie Wood. He puffed cigarettes for his roles as Paulo di Leo in "A Roman Spring for Mrs. Stone" in 1961, in "The Only Game in Town" (with smoker co-star Elizabeth Taylor) in 1969, cigars for "McCabe and Mrs. Miller" in 1970 and as Nicky in "The Fortune" (when it was most obvious that he really wasn't a smoker) in 1975, plus he dubbed smoking a dooby in 1998 "Bulworth".
Barely smoked, never drank. He DID always have a very expressive face. As far as the aging went. I know he looked younger than his actual age for
the longest time and it bothered him.
Some of his best friends (including Jack Nicholson) have related how Warren
would envy their receding hairlines and bags under their eyes. They'd of
course call him crazy, but he couldn't wait to get, as he called it, "character"
in his face.
Despite the popular belief that he is "so vain", you'd be surprised how untrue
that actually is. Many of his careers choices have been (and plenty of critics
have hinted at this regularly) as if to excuse himself for the way he looked.
For instance> his debut part of Bud in "Splendor in the Grass" was taylor
made for him, written by William Inge who had a massive crush on him.
The part was too close for comfort to Warren> the handsome, football hero,
popular schoolboy.

So for his next part he wanted the complete opposite. That became the
sleazy gigolo in "Mrs. Stone", followed by another opposite to his character>
the lazy, Berry-Berry in "All Fall Down".
When the media were beginning to refer to him as a sex symbol, he had real
problems with it. He was quoted as saying
"I was in Paris and I opened the door of my hotel room one morning to see
this copy of the Herald Tribune lying on the carpet. And there was this large
picture of me. I looked down and my stomach just turned over.
I realized that things were getting out of hand, and in the future I would
have to try and insulate myself
."
This all at the time of promoting "Splendor" a year after it was shot.
It got to be so bad, that right before going on stage for a press conference
about the movie with girlfriend Natalie Wood, he got physically ill and
vomited behind the curtains before facing the lineup of reporters.
So, before he got the much desired "character" in his face, he tried to avoid
being typecast as the handsome, romantic lead. Another reason for him
turning down many roles that became great hits for other actors.
